When using the case-sensitive and full words filters, you can search using the new ...Aug 30, 2023 · Search for a Word in PDF File in Mac: Step 1. Right-click on the PDF file and open it with the Preview app. Step 2. Once the file opens in the Preview app, you can search using the search bar available on the top right. You can also use the "Command" + "F" on the keyboard to bring it to the focus. Key Takeaways Use the search operator “filetype: pdf” after your keywords to find PDF files on Google. Add -site: followed by a domain you want to exclude if you don’t want PDFs from certain websites. To be specific in your search, put quotation marks around exact phrases and use a minus sign (-) to remove unwanted words. Check for … 1. Select the Edit tab. 2. Select Advanced Search. Pro Tip: PC users can type Shift + Ctrl + F instead of accessing Advanced Search through the Edit tab. Step 6: On the Ribbon, click ... ewr boston The Search window offers more options and more kinds of searches than the Find toolbar. When you use the Search window, object data and image XIF (extended image file format) metadata are also searched. For searches across multiple PDFs, Acrobat also looks at document properties and XMP metadata, and it searches indexed …Clicking on a search result jumps you to that occurrence.
